When it comes to cleaning the exterior of your home or business, traditional pressure washing methods may not always be the best option. This is where a softwash system comes in handy. A softwash system is a gentler, more effective way to clean surfaces without causing damage. In this article, we will delve into the benefits of using a softwash system for your cleaning needs.
First and foremost, a softwash system is safer for delicate surfaces. Traditional pressure washing can be too harsh on certain materials such as stucco, siding, and roof shingles. The high pressure can strip away paint, damage wood, and even cause cracks in the surface. With a softwash system, lower pressure is used along with specialized cleaning solutions to gently remove dirt, grime, and mold without causing any damage. This makes it the perfect choice for cleaning sensitive surfaces on your property.
Another benefit of using a softwash system is its effectiveness in removing contaminants. Mold, mildew, algae, and other organic growths can be difficult to remove with just water and scrubbing. A softwash system uses biodegradable chemicals that not only clean the surface but also kill the spores at their roots. This ensures a longer-lasting clean and prevents mold from growing back quickly. The cleaning solutions used in a softwash system are safe for the environment and do not pose any health risks to humans or pets.
